Sebay Mill Holiday Apartments. World class award-winning luxurious four and five star self-catering apartments. Located six miles from Kirkwall in the beautiful east mainland of Orkney. Each one to two bedroom apartments boast luxurious modern living spaces. We are a short distance from the spectacular beaches and cliff walks of Deerness. A local Orkney welcome pack with some wonderful jams, oatcakes, cheese & a miniature of local whiskey! awaits you on your arrival so you can relax right away. Sebay Mill has undergone a complete restoration to provide you with a very special experience!• Rural location • Local welcome pack • Linen/Towels provided• Private garden area • Cots available • Private parking• Near heritage sites • Free WiFi • Bus route nearby• Restaurant/Pub nearby • Airport 3 miles.

We booked The Kiln apartment for our staycation and couldn’t fault it. There is parking for each apartment and the location is great, easy to find as in main road from Kirkwall to Deerness. The apartment was spacious and the decor lovely, very tastefully finished. The Kiln is a 2 bed apartment on the first & second floors of the building. Bedroom had plenty storage if staying longer and the bathroom is a good size with both a shower and bath. The second bedroom ( we didn’t use) was bunk beds but again plenty space for kids. The upstairs area is open plan living/kitchen/dining area and is bright and airy with large windows. Kitchen had everything needed. The wee welcome pack was a treat. Thought the booking process Sheena was extremely welcoming and really did make our trip totally hassle free. We had a great time in Orkney and would not hesitate to rebook Sebay Mill.
